Description
English: Theoretical torque curve of a clock mainspring. From Hooke's Law the torque exerted by the spring decreases linearly to zero as it unwinds. At the left side where the spring approaches full wind, all the slack is gone from between the turns and they are pressed tight together, so the torque increases.
